| Aspect | Internship Aviation Electrical Engineer | Aviation Electrical Engineer |
|---|
| Required Credentials | Enrolled in or recent graduate of electrical engineering or related program |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ering, professional licensure often preferred |
| Work Environment | Internship setting, supervised, entry-level tasks | Full-time professional role, responsible for design, testing, maintenance |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Internship programs in aerospace companies, airlines, defense contractors | Airlines, aerospace manufacturers, defense agencies |
In summary, an Internship Aviation Electrical Engineer is a temporary, entry-level position for students or recent graduates gaining industry experience, while an Aviation Electrical Engineer is a full-time professional responsible for electrical systems design, maintenance, and troubleshooting in aviation settings.
